WebMar 10, 2024 · The snowflake method is a novel designing technique that is based around a story-building concept that starts with a simplistic deep theme and develops into a complexity, finished novel. The idea is, you start with a simple sentence and transform it into a full-fledged novel. WebFeb 14, 2024 · Snowflake Method Created by writing coach Randy Ingermanson, the snowflake method starts with one central story idea that is continually expanded upon until it’s a full novel. The process is as follows: 1. Write a one-sentence summary of your story Condense your story premise into one-line. What is the essence of your story?
